Income in Tomago

What people and households earn each week, and how incomes are spread.

Weekly incomes in Tomago (L) have dropped sharply since 2011. The typical household now earns just $788 a week, which is far below the national figure and among the lowest for similar areas. This significant decline reflects a broader trend of falling earnings across family and personal levels.

Income spread

High earners and the full distribution.

High earners are rare here, with only 5.5% of households earning $3,000 or more a week, a figure that fell 15 points since 2011. This is far below the 22.6% national average, while 42.9% of individuals earn under $650 a week.
